Cannot install this hardware. An error occurred during the installation of the device
Can someone please HELP ME - I get the following error message: cannot install this hardware. An error occurred during the installation of the device. They system cannot find the specified file.
I am not able to connect any hardware. It started all of a sudden. I can't connect my mouse so it before I'm not able to use my computer. He did the same thing when I put in a USB key, there was the same error message.
If something is damaged? How can I resolve this - pleasee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eeee.
Looks like you may have a virus or other malware. Get your updated antivirus program and start safe mode. Note that some viruses can hide from your normal antivirus program, so you really need to scan mode without failure. To enter in Safe Mode when you turn on first, press F8 on every seconds until you get the menu, and then select Safe Mode. Then run a complete system scan.
Microsoft has suggestions and offerings to
http://Windows.Microsoft.com/en-us/Windows7/how-do-I-remove-a-computer-virus
Moderator Forum Keith has a few suggestions along this line to
http://answers.Microsoft.com/en-us/Windows/Forum/Windows_7-performance/Windows-Explorer-has-stopped-working/6ab02526-5071-4DCC-895F-d90202bad8b3
If that suits him fine. If this is not the case, use system restore to go back to an earlier date at the beginning of the problem. To run system restore, click Start-> programs-> Accessories-> System Tools-> system restore. Click on the box that says show more restore points.
You can check the corrupted system files. Open an administrator command prompt and run SFC if the above does not help. Click START, and then type sfc in the search box, right-click to SFC. EXE, then click on run as administrator. Then from the command prompt, type sfc/scannow.
Finally if all else fails, you can look at the rather cryptic system event log. To make, click Start-> Control Panel-> administration-> event viewer tools. Once in Event Viewer system log-click and scroll entries looking for these "error" with indicator see if you can find guidance on where the problem may be.

Error 1935. An error occurred during the installation of Assembly
Microsoft.VC80.ATL.type = "win32", version = "8.0.50727.5592", publicKeyToken = "1fc8b3b9a1e18e3b", processorArchitecture is "amd64"It of a long story, but basically will not install Visual C++ 2005, Visual C++ 2008, neither will the window update or standalone. Many other programs like Acrobat will not be installed. giving me the same error. I tried clearing the log and restart, tried in safe mode, tried searching. A lot of people have this problem, few solutions.I use Vista Home premium x 64 sp2 and a processor intel T5800 (so it's weird that he said processor = amd 64 Architecture)Anyway, any help is appreciated. Looked everywhere, looks like I've tried everything.Hello
This problem may occur when the Microsoft .NET Framework installation on the computer is damaged or is missing.
Method 1: Follow the steps described in the article below
Error message when you try to install an Office program: "Error 1935. An error occurred during the installation of assembly component"
http://support.Microsoft.com/kb/926804Method 2: Also see the article below for measures to address this problem.
Error 1935.An error occurred during the installation of assembly ' Microsoft.VC90.ATL, version
http://support.Microsoft.com/kb/970652Important This section, method, or task contains steps that tell you how to modify the registry. However, serious problems can occur if you modify the registry incorrectly. Therefore, make sure that you proceed with caution. For added protection, back up the registry before you edit it. Then you can restore the registry if a problem occurs. Hello myducks,
To answer your question about the SFC command, follow these steps:
First of all, we run System File Checker to see if you have a corrupt file system.
Click Start
Open an elevated command prompt.To do this, click Start, click programs, accessories principally made, right-click Guest, and then click Run as administrator.
If you are prompted for an administrator password or a confirmation, type the password, or click on allow.
At the command prompt, type the following command and press ENTER:SFC/scannow
This will check for any violation of the integrity and repair any damaged operating system files.
Then restart your system.
Please see the article (KB) knowledge base if you find corrupted files:
Article 929833 - how to use the System File Checker tool to fix the system files missing or corrupted on Windows Vista or Windows 7If you were able to successfully run the SFC, then run chkdsk:
1 disable any security software before you attempt to upgrade or do a clean install.
2. make sure that your computer is updated (devices and applications)
3. disconnect all external devices before installing.
4. check your hard disk for errors:
Click Start
Type: CMD, according to the results, right-click CMD
Click on "Run as Administrator"
At the command prompt, type: chkdsk /f /r
